COMP2402 - Abstract Data Types and Algorithms
Course: COMP2402 (Abstract Data Types and Algorithms) in COMP department at Carleton University.
Credit Hours: 0.5 • Academic Level: year 0 undergraduate course
Course Requirements: Requires 2 prerequisite courses
Prerequisite Chain Depth: 2 levels of foundational courses required
Future Opportunities: Unlocks 15 advanced courses for further study
Course Type: Core pathway course - critical for degree progression
Part of the COMP curriculum at Carleton University, helping students progress through degree requirements.
Courses unlocked by COMP2402
- COMP3000 - Operating Systems
- SYSC3303 - Real-Time Concurrent Systems
- COMP3005 - Database Management Systems
- COMP3009 - Computer Graphics
- COMP3203 - Principles of Computer Networks
- COMP3301 - Technical Writing for Computer Science
- COMP3804 - Design and Analysis of Algorithms I
- COMP3002 - Compiler Construction
- COMP3007 - Programming Paradigms
- COMP3501 - Foundations of Game Programming and Computer Graphics
- COMP3105 - Introduction to Machine Learning
- COMP3106 - Introduction to Artificial Intelligence
- COMP4009 - Programming for Clusters and Multi-Core Processors
- COMP4010 - Introduction to Reinforcement Learning
- MATH3804 - Design and Analysis of Algorithms I
Academic Planning at Carleton University
Students planning COMP2402 at Carleton University should complete 2 prerequisites before enrollment.
Future Pathways: Completing COMP2402 enables enrollment in 15 advanced courses, opening specialization opportunities in the COMP program.
This year 0 course at Carleton University integrates into structured degree pathways for COMP programs, supporting timely graduation and academic progression.